Mnemonic
ただいま tadaima — kanji 只今 = "just (只) + now (今)" = "right now / just this moment". Etymologically a clipping of "I have just [returned]" — the verb 戻りました is dropped. Paired with おかえり(なさい) ("welcome back"). A return-to-home ritual. The kanji form 只今 still functions as the formal time adverb "just now" in news and announcements, branching from greeting to time-adverb. Everyday writing uses kana ただいま.
